Building Craftsman
1 week ago
We are seeking a Building Craftsman to join our team at Centro. As a key member of our construction crew, you will be responsible for providing trade skills, knowledge, and experience to undertake carpentry work in a safe and timely manner.
Skill Requirements- We are looking for someone with advanced skills in carpentry and construction procedures.
- The ideal candidate will have the ability to perform various tasks, including site setup, framing, steel tying, concrete work, drywall installation, cladding, window installation, and door hanging.
- Precision is key in this role, as you will need to ensure accurate work at varying heights and levels while maintaining structural alignment.
- You will also be proficiently operating tools such as nail guns, skill saws, electric drills, grinders, and drop saws.
- Prior experience in the construction industry is essential, as is the ability to maintain a clean and safe worksite following health and safety regulations.
- Ability to read plans and specs for material requirements, dimensions, and installation procedures is also required.
